How to play Pokemon The New Kanto
Navigate your trainer through the game world using the D-pad. The A button is used to confirm actions and interact with objects or characters, while the B button is typically used to cancel selections or run when held down. The L and R buttons can be used to cycle through menus or perform specific actions in battle.
About Pokemon The New Kanto
Pokemon The New Kanto is a narrative-driven GBA ROM hack created by Regulone328, built on the foundation of Pokemon Fire Red. This is not the Kanto you remember; the timeline has splintered, creating a world filled with anomalies. Instead of a traditional starter, you begin your journey with Riolu and quickly realize that familiar faces and paths have changed. Brock is missing from his gym, Phoebe has replaced Misty, and Giratina roams Saffron City, revealing that Arceus itself has been sealed away.
The gameplay introduces modern mechanics including a Dynamax Band, Mega Evolutions found within 'Dark Rifts,' and the DexNav. The world features a unique blend of cultures, such as the Kanto-Hoenn fusion of Rider Town. New Pokémon variants like 'Toddit'—a Ditto that transforms permanently before battle—add a layer of unpredictability. Players can also unlock Gen 9 starters and encounter roaming legends from multiple generations, including Rayquaza and Dialga, as soon as they reach Vermilion City.
The story takes a darker turn as you uncover the fate of the original heroes. You will face a disguise-wearing MissingNo. on Route 23 and find an aged, dying Brendan in a hidden cave. After defeating Eternatus, the world fractures again: wild Pokémon change, trainer AI shifts, and the final arc begins. With daily rewards like Rare Candies and guaranteed Shiny Lugia or Ho-Oh in the S.S. Anne, this hack offers a challenging and hauntingly beautiful expansion of the Kanto lore.
